What to Pack

These are the main items we recommend bringing where applicable.

Drink Bottle

Named if possible

A clearly labelled drink bottle helps children stay hydrated throughout the day and makes it easier to keep personal items organised.

Hat

For outdoor play

A hat is important for outdoor activities and helps support sun safety during play and excursions outside.

Spare Clothes

Comfort and practicality

A full change of clothes is always helpful in case of spills, messy play, toileting accidents, or water play.

Comfort Item

If your child needs one

If your child has a comfort toy, blanket, or familiar item, bringing it can help them settle and feel more secure during the day.
